Indium Phosphide Photonic Integrated Circuits: Technology and Applications

BiCMOS and Compound Semiconductor Integrated Circuits and Technology Symposium, 2018
A summary of photonic integrated circuit (PIC) platforms is provided with emphasis on indium phosphide (InP). Examples of InP PICs were fabricated and characterized for free space laser communications, Lidar, and microwave photonics.

Ion implantation in indium phosphide

Nuclear Instruments and Methods, 1981
Abstract Carrier-concentration and mobility profiles of Zn- and Mg-implanted layers formed in Fe-doped semi-insulating InP have been investigated by successive Hall-effect and sheet-resistivity measurements followed by an anodic oxide growth and stripping process.
